Default Koni's or Tokico's for drag racing and spring rates for ground controls

ok im going to purchase my suspension setup this week and i searched already and couldn't find what i was looking for so i figured i make a post.So here are my questions. 1 which is better for drag racing koni yellows or tokico illuminas. 2 on ground controls i am thinking about what spring rates to ask for. I was thinking of something like somewhere in the lines of 500-700 on the front and 800-1000 on the rear. Crazy? what setup are u guys running? What is the best setup for the track?( if u need to know i have a 92 hatchback and im going to be running a ls motor with boost). Spread the knowledge to me my fellow racers.

Default Re: Koni's or Tokico's for drag racing and spring rates for ground controls (bubblebackinSI)

is this going to be a full drag setup or street setup as well. the high rate spring for the rear is a good choice for Race days only. but not recommended for street driving.
Diff people will have mixed feelings with the Tokico and Koni setup. I prefer the Koni myself overall.

Default Re: Koni's or Tokico's for drag racing and spring rates for ground controls (bubblebackinSI)

I too would recommend Konis....The Tokicos(sp) have a tendancy to blow prematurely...Im sure some of you guys can relate.... ...As far as spring rate goes..u have to go with what you can tolerate...There is always a compromise between a race setup and a street setup...A higher rate would be better for race days but not for ur *** on the street all day...

It goes back to a very deep saying, "What do you want a street car or a race car, you cant have both!"

Default Re: Koni's or Tokico's for drag racing and spring rates for ground controls (bubblebackinSI)

I would recommend Koni yellows. Your exact spring rate depends on the car, street car, track only, etc. You would want STIFF suspension in the rear of the car so it doesnt squat when you launch
